Retina-Vitreous Associates Medical Group in Valley Village, CA specializes in treating diseases affecting the retina, vitreous, and macula. The medical group is renowned for its state-of-the-art diagnostic equipment and treatment facilities, which include a visual function laboratory offering comprehensive electrophysiology testing.
The physicians at Retina-Vitreous Associates are nationally recognized for their expertise and actively engage in clinical trials to evaluate new therapies for various retinal diseases. Beyond clinical services, the group provides educational and consulting services to ophthalmic communities locally, nationally, and internationally.
Collaborating with the USC Roski Eye Institute, Retina-Vitreous Associates plays an integral role in training the next generation of vitreoretinal surgeons through a top Vitreo-Retinal Fellowship program. All doctors at the medical group hold academic appointments at the Keck School of Medicine at the University of Southern California.
